Output 57856e17f0e5b6e52ab3dd3be8cbb5b4bfac192e6a9b4a29ea1f30a624ebaba7:0

value
5333005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82fcbfde4d409927a294b5a2e73d0f406764f363 OP_EQUAL
address
3DdcYpjhJ2vPQfgU47Z2uo69XcgG5NdTkr
transaction
57856e17f0e5b6e52ab3dd3be8cbb5b4bfac192e6a9b4a29ea1f30a624ebaba7
spent
true